Nursing the Cardiac Patient is a practical guide that addresses the management of cardiac patients across the spectrum of health care settings. It assists nurses to develop a complete understanding of the current evidence-based practice and principles underlying the care and management of the cardiac patient. It combines theoretical and practical components of cardiac care in an accessible and user-friendly format, with case studies and practical examples throughout.

Topics covered in this volume include assessment of the cardiovascular system, diagnosing acute coronary syndrome, emergency cardiac care, cardiac rehabilitation and the management of chronic cardiac conditions.

Key features

  • Aimed at students and newly qualified nurses
  • Added value to Allied Health Professionals who have contact with the cardiac patient
  • Explores care of cardiac patients across primary, secondary and tertiary care
  • Includes step-by-step clinical guidance
  • Evidence based
